Best tool yet, for me..
Single edge razor blade.
It'll cut off all the active rust.
Then steel wool n WD-40.
If that doesn't do it, out comes the wet n dry paper @ no more than 600 grt. to start, and adjust my grt. as needed.

Always the least evasive first.
Its hard to beat the SE blade for rust removal.

For the jimps I've used a stainless steel tooth brush, or a bore brush from a gun cleaning kit. For the worst in the jimps I've resorted to the dremmel and a SS wire wheel ( last resort). But still hard to beat the SE blade. [emoji6]
